Shah Rukh Khan

Shah Rukh Khan, popularly known as the “King of Bollywood,” is one of India’s most iconic and influential actors, celebrated for his charisma, versatility, and enduring appeal. Born on November 2, 1965, in New Delhi, India, he began his acting career in television before making his Bollywood debut with Deewana (1992), quickly rising to superstardom with films like Dilwale Dulhania Le Jayenge, Dil Se, Kuch Kuch Hota Hai, and My Name Is Khan.

Over the decades, Shah Rukh has delivered countless memorable performances across genres—romance, action, drama, and comedy—earning numerous Filmfare Awards and international recognition. Beyond acting, he is a film producer, television presenter, entrepreneur, and philanthropist, with a global fan base that spans continents.

Known for his intelligence, wit, and humility, Shah Rukh Khan continues to inspire generations, remaining a towering figure in Indian cinema and a symbol of passion, dedication, and charisma.
